Searched refs:recordSimpleInfos_ (Results 1 - 2 of 2) sorted by relevance
/arkcompiler/ets_runtime/ecmascript/pgo_profiler/ |
H A D | pgo_profiler_decoder.cpp | 40 if (!recordSimpleInfos_) { in Load() 41 recordSimpleInfos_ = std::make_unique<PGORecordSimpleInfos>(hotnessThreshold_); in Load() 43 LoadAbcIdPool(externalAbcFilePool, *recordSimpleInfos_, addr); in Load() 44 recordSimpleInfos_->ParseFromBinary(addr, header_, abcFilePool_); in Load() 192 if (recordSimpleInfos_) { in Clear() 193 recordSimpleInfos_->Clear(); in Clear() 207 return recordSimpleInfos_->Match(GetNormalizedFileDesc(jsPandaFile), recordName, EntityId(methodId)); in Match() 215 return recordSimpleInfos_->GetHClassTreeDesc(profileType, desc); in GetHClassTreeDesc() 225 return recordSimpleInfos_->GetMismatchResult(GetNormalizedFileDesc(jsPandaFile), totalMethodCount, in GetMismatchResult() 241 if (!recordSimpleInfos_) { in InitMergeData() [all...] |
H A D | pgo_profiler_decoder.h | 87 recordSimpleInfos_->Update(GetNormalizedFileDesc(jsPandaFile), callback); in Update() 96 recordSimpleInfos_->Update(GetNormalizedFileDesc(jsPandaFile), recordName, callback); in Update() 112 return recordSimpleInfos_->GetTypeInfo(GetNormalizedFileDesc(jsPandaFile), recordName, methodName, checksum, in GetTypeInfo() 115 recordSimpleInfos_->GetTypeInfo(GetNormalizedFileDesc(jsPandaFile), recordName, methodName, callback); in GetTypeInfo() 124 recordSimpleInfos_->MatchAndMarkMethod(GetNormalizedFileDesc(jsPandaFile), recordName, methodName, methodId); in MatchAndMarkMethod() 143 return recordSimpleInfos_->IterateHClassTreeDesc(callback); in IterateHClassTreeDesc() 152 return recordSimpleInfos_->IterateProtoTransitionPool(callback); in IterateProtoTransitionPool() 172 return *recordSimpleInfos_; in GetRecordSimpleInfos() 234 std::unique_ptr<PGORecordSimpleInfos> recordSimpleInfos_; member in panda::ecmascript::pgo::PGOProfilerDecoder
|
Completed in 1 milliseconds